My approach

Modular Thinking

Ability to design gameplay mechanics and systems that are modular, scalable, and reusable across multiple projects or game features. This involves creating clean, well-structured code and Blueprints with clear separation of concerns to allow easy iteration and expansion.

Team Communication

Strong skill in bridging the gap between design, art, and engineering teams. A technical game designer should translate gameplay ideas into technical requirements clearly, collaborate effectively with programmers and artists, and incorporate feedback to refine systems.

Optimized Systems

Proactively consider performance implications during design and implementation phases, optimizing code and assets to ensure smooth gameplay even under complex scenarios like multiplayer or large open worlds.

Iterative Prototyping

Use rapid prototyping and iterative development combined with analytics or player feedback to fine-tune game mechanics. Emphasize flexibility in systems to enable quick testing and adjustments, supporting a player-centric design process.
